Here are some added candle light burning pointers you may find to be valuable: Silk, cotton, linen, and rayon are a few of one of the most flammable materials.
It's also best to position candle lights on a level surface area, such as a table or counter top, far from kids, family pets, or swinging doors that can knock them over. Rugs and carpets are usually made from combustible materials and have a high fire danger. Candles. If you light a candle light in the living space and after that make a decision to wash, bring your candle with you to the washroom or put it out making use of a candle snuffer
